单片机内部结构分为哪几个部分

发布网友 发布时间:2024-10-23 14:56

我来回答

1个回答

热心网友 时间:2024-10-25 06:28

单片机的内部结构复杂而精密,主要包括以下几个关键部分:

1. ***处理器(CPU)**:作为单片机的核心部件,CPU负责执行指令、进行计算和控制数据流,是单片机实现各种功能的基础。它通常由算术逻辑单元、控制单元和寄存器等组成。

2. **存储器**:存储器用于存储单片机的程序指令、数据和变量等。主要包括程序存储器(如ROM、Flash)和数据存储器(如RAM)以及非易失性存储器(如EEPROM)。程序存储器用于存放程序代码,而数据存储器则用于存放临时数据和变量。

3. **输入输出接口(I/O)**:单片机通过输入输出接口与外部环境进行数据交互。这些接口包括GPIO(通用输入输出接口)、UART(串行通信接口)、SPI(串行外设接口)等,它们使得单片机能够与其他设备或传感器进行连接和通信。

4. **时钟电路**:时钟电路为单片机提供稳定的时钟信号,以同步单片机的内部操作。它是确保单片机能够按照预定的时序执行指令的关键部件。

5. **中断系统**:中断系统使单片机能够在执行程序的过程中响应来自内部或外部的中断请求,暂停当前任务,转而执行相应的中断服务程序。这提高了单片机的实时响应能力和多任务处理能力。

6. **定时/计数器**:定时/计数器用于实现定时或计数功能,这对于需要精确时间控制或计数操作的应用场景尤为重要。

综上所述,单片机的内部结构由CPU、存储器、输入输出接口、时钟电路、中断系统和定时/计数器等多个关键部分组成,它们共同协作,使得单片机能够执行复杂的指令、处理数据、与外部设备进行通信以及响应外部中断等任务。
声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。
E-MAIL:11247931@qq.com